Transaction 3473133c21edcbe4568d04a9502d0ee13d11d369b401623f62e2a81b6578c718

1 Input
2 Outputs
  • 3473133c21edcbe4568d04a9502d0ee13d11d369b401623f62e2a81b6578c718:0
  • value  309385192
    address  13RHBhYF7ijYUHjdZS4Sw78z5LSqoxeqgi
  • 3473133c21edcbe4568d04a9502d0ee13d11d369b401623f62e2a81b6578c718:1
  • value  129354808
    address  14mw2MLtvhDjhCK2XtDcCJfQGguH84Kmy8